bin: always define MESA_GIT_SHA1 to make it directly usable in code
Signed-off-by: Eric Engestrom <eric.engestrom@intel.com> Reviewed-by: Emil Velikov <emil.velikov@collabora.com>
This commit is contained in:
parent
471f708ed6
commit
bc8abc1adf
|
@ -47,6 +47,6 @@ args = parser.parse_args()
|
|||
|
||||
git_sha1 = os.environ.get('MESA_GIT_SHA1_OVERRIDE', get_git_sha1())[:10]
|
||||
if git_sha1:
|
||||
write_if_different('#define MESA_GIT_SHA1 "git-' + git_sha1 + '"')
|
||||
write_if_different('#define MESA_GIT_SHA1 " (git-' + git_sha1 + ')"')
|
||||
else:
|
||||
write_if_different('')
|
||||
write_if_different('#define MESA_GIT_SHA1 ""')
|
||||
|
|
|
@ -889,11 +889,7 @@ init_logging(struct pipe_screen *screen)
|
|||
svga_host_log(host_log);
|
||||
|
||||
util_snprintf(host_log, sizeof(host_log) - strlen(log_prefix),
|
||||
"%s%s"
|
||||
#ifdef MESA_GIT_SHA1
|
||||
" (" MESA_GIT_SHA1 ")"
|
||||
#endif
|
||||
, log_prefix, PACKAGE_VERSION);
|
||||
"%s%s" MESA_GIT_SHA1, log_prefix, PACKAGE_VERSION);
|
||||
svga_host_log(host_log);
|
||||
|
||||
/* If the SVGA_EXTRA_LOGGING env var is set, log the process's command
|
||||
|
|
|
@ -322,11 +322,7 @@ clGetDeviceInfo(cl_device_id d_dev, cl_device_info param,
|
|||
break;
|
||||
|
||||
case CL_DEVICE_VERSION:
|
||||
buf.as_string() = "OpenCL " + dev.device_version() + " Mesa " PACKAGE_VERSION
|
||||
#ifdef MESA_GIT_SHA1
|
||||
" (" MESA_GIT_SHA1 ")"
|
||||
#endif
|
||||
;
|
||||
buf.as_string() = "OpenCL " + dev.device_version() + " Mesa " PACKAGE_VERSION MESA_GIT_SHA1;
|
||||
break;
|
||||
|
||||
case CL_DEVICE_EXTENSIONS:
|
||||
|
|
|
@ -62,11 +62,7 @@ clover::GetPlatformInfo(cl_platform_id d_platform, cl_platform_info param,
|
|||
static const std::string version_string =
|
||||
debug_get_option("CLOVER_PLATFORM_VERSION_OVERRIDE", "1.1");
|
||||
|
||||
buf.as_string() = "OpenCL " + version_string + " Mesa " PACKAGE_VERSION
|
||||
#ifdef MESA_GIT_SHA1
|
||||
" (" MESA_GIT_SHA1 ")"
|
||||
#endif
|
||||
;
|
||||
buf.as_string() = "OpenCL " + version_string + " Mesa " PACKAGE_VERSION MESA_GIT_SHA1;
|
||||
break;
|
||||
}
|
||||
case CL_PLATFORM_NAME:
|
||||
|
|
|
@ -404,11 +404,7 @@ one_time_init( struct gl_context *ctx )
|
|||
|
||||
#if defined(DEBUG)
|
||||
if (MESA_VERBOSE != 0) {
|
||||
_mesa_debug(ctx, "Mesa " PACKAGE_VERSION " DEBUG build"
|
||||
#ifdef MESA_GIT_SHA1
|
||||
" (" MESA_GIT_SHA1 ")"
|
||||
#endif
|
||||
"\n");
|
||||
_mesa_debug(ctx, "Mesa " PACKAGE_VERSION " DEBUG build" MESA_GIT_SHA1 "\n");
|
||||
}
|
||||
#endif
|
||||
}
|
||||
|
|
|
@ -121,11 +121,7 @@ create_version_string(struct gl_context *ctx, const char *prefix)
|
|||
ctx->VersionString = malloc(max);
|
||||
if (ctx->VersionString) {
|
||||
_mesa_snprintf(ctx->VersionString, max,
|
||||
"%s%u.%u%s Mesa " PACKAGE_VERSION
|
||||
#ifdef MESA_GIT_SHA1
|
||||
" (" MESA_GIT_SHA1 ")"
|
||||
#endif
|
||||
,
|
||||
"%s%u.%u%s Mesa " PACKAGE_VERSION MESA_GIT_SHA1,
|
||||
prefix,
|
||||
ctx->Version / 10, ctx->Version % 10,
|
||||
(ctx->API == API_OPENGL_CORE) ? " (Core Profile)" :
|
||||
|
|
Loading…
Reference in New Issue